#fb9699 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fb9699 is composed of 98.4% red, 58.8%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 40.2% magenta, 39%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 358.2 degrees, a saturation of 92.7% and a lightness of 78.6%. #fb9699 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f72d33. Closest websafe color is: #ff9999.

Shades and Tints of #fb9699

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080001 is the darkest color, while #fff4f5 is the lightest one.
